If Boeing produces 9 jets per month, its long-run total cost is $9.0 million per month. If it produces 10 jets per month, its long-run total cost is $9.5 million per month. Does Boeing exhibit economies or diseconomies of scale?

With 9 jets, The average total cost , ATCATC = $9.0million9=$1.0million\frac{\$9.0 million}{9}=\$1.0 million and


with 10 jets, ATC=$0.95million10=$0.95millionATC=\frac{\$0.95 million}{10}=\$0.95 million


Therefore Boeing exhibits economies of scale (increasing returns to scale). Long run average total costs decreases with increase in output.
